Understanding Post Alignment and Gate Motor Wear
If an automatic gate stops moving, it is common to assume the motor has failed. However, simply replacing the motor without addressing underlying structural issues can lead to repeated failures.
In some areas, shifting ground or settling soil can affect gate posts. If gate posts shift or lean over time, it can impact the alignment of the entire system.
When a post leans, the resulting gate sag can place extra strain on the gate operator. This resistance can cause the motor to work harder, potentially leading to premature wear or electrical issues. How much does gate repair cost in Gibsonton, FL?
According to limited available online cost guide sources, minor gate repairs such as sensor realignments or hinge lubrication may estimate between $150 and $300, while more extensive repairs like post stabilization or motor replacement could range from $500 to $1,500 or more. However, neutral verification for these figures is lacking, and actual costs depend on the specific issues identified during an inspection. We provide estimates before work begins.

How long does a typical gate repair service take?
Most standard electrical or mechanical repairs, such as replacing safety sensors, reprogramming access codes, or swapping out a control board, take about one to three hours. If your project requires structural welding, post-setting, or a gate installation project, it may take one or two days to complete properly.
